Islands is a region in the Cape Cod region of Massachusetts that includes Martha's Vineyard, Nantucket, and the town of Gosnold. Gosnold is very sparsely populated and is comprised of the Elizabeth Islands, all of which are privately owned except for one. Martha's Vineyard and Nantucket are very popular tourist destinations.
Towns
- Nantucket - The town of Nantucket is co-extensive to the island of the same name.
- Gosnold - The public portion of these islands is on Cuttyhunk Island.
